WebbShould I use alcohol or peroxide in my ear? Rinsing the ear canal with h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) results in oxygen bubbling off and water being left behind—wet, warm ear canals make good incubators for growth of bacteria. Flushing the ear canal with rubbing alcohol displaces the water and dries the canal skin. Webb17 sep. 2024 · Yes, it is safe to put rubbing alcohol in your ear. WebbCan I drain my ear with alcohol? Try rubbing alcohol or hydrogen peroxide. This can help dry out the ear canal. Use caution, however. Don't use alcohol drops if you have a perforated eardrum, as this will cause severe pain, and high levels could be toxic to the ear.
